John Clarke: Explorer of the Coast Mountains by Lisa Baile is a biography that delves into the remarkable life of a mountaineer who defied conventions. With an unyielding passion for exploration, Clarke embarked on countless expeditions, earning him legendary status among his peers. A self-taught climber with no interest in "trophy climbs", Clarke instead focused on discovering new territory and achieving first ascents. He was known for his unconventional approach to climbing, often travelling light and relying on homemade granola for sustenance. Despite his modest nature, Clarke's reputation grew through his remarkable achievements, which were matched only by the respect he commanded from those who knew him. This book offers a unique insight into Clarke's life, drawing on his own words and photographs as well as accounts from friends and acquaintances. A fitting tribute to a man whose contributions to environmental education have left a lasting impact, John Clarke: Explorer of the Coast Mountains is an inspiring read that sheds light on a remarkable individual.
